Course Description

When promoting a process focus, it is essential that you rely on facts and not assumptions. Using techniques such as visualizing a process through workflow diagrams can help you identify your process needs. In this lesson, you will explore the use of workflow diagrams. You will also identify common workflow concerns such as bottlenecks, starving, and variability. As you progress through this lesson, you will have opportunities to examine how the use of lean thinking and diagrams can aid in not only identifying, but also addressing these problems.

Benefits to the Learner

  • Explore the use of workflow diagrams to visualize and evaluate processes that promote high-quality products
  • Consider the commonalities, differences, and trade-offs of different approaches to process improvement
  • Examine common workflow concerns, such as bottlenecks and variability, and assess how you can mitigate them in your organization
